OlmSAS

expect class OlmSAS : WantsToBeFree
actual class OlmSAS : WantsToBeFree
actual class OlmSAS : WantsToBeFree

Types

Link copied to clipboard
expect object Companion
actual object Companion
actual object Companion

Properties

Link copied to clipboard
expect val publicKey: String
actual val publicKey: String
actual val publicKey: String

Functions

Link copied to clipboard
expect fun calculateMac(input: String, info: String): String
actual fun calculateMac(input: String, info: String): String
actual fun calculateMac(input: String, info: String): String
Link copied to clipboard
expect fun calculateMacFixedBase64(input: String, info: String): String
actual fun calculateMacFixedBase64(input: String, info: String): String
actual fun calculateMacFixedBase64(input: String, info: String): String
Link copied to clipboard
expect open override fun free()
actual open override fun free()
actual open override fun free()
Link copied to clipboard
expect fun generateShortCode(info: String, numberOfBytes: Int): ByteArray
actual fun generateShortCode(info: String, numberOfBytes: Int): ByteArray
actual fun generateShortCode(info: String, numberOfBytes: Int): ByteArray
Link copied to clipboard
expect fun setTheirPublicKey(theirPublicKey: String)
actual fun setTheirPublicKey(theirPublicKey: String)
actual fun setTheirPublicKey(theirPublicKey: String)